Gershon Bachus Vintners sits in the heart of Temecula Valley, where the landscape rolls with vineyards and horse farms stretching toward the mountains. This is a private estate winery, so the experience feels more intimate than what you’d find at some of the bigger operations along Rancho California Road. The views are genuinely impressive—you can see why people make the drive out here specifically for that scenery alone.

What makes this place work well for a dog visit is that leashed dogs are welcome throughout the property. You’re not confined to a patio or single tasting room. Your dog can walk alongside you as you move through the grounds and take in those mountain vistas while you’re sampling their wines. The setting has that quiet, unhurried quality that makes you actually want to stay for a while instead of rushing through a tasting list.

Gershon Bachus produces award-winning wines, and because it’s a smaller operation, you get a more personal interaction with staff who know their product thoroughly. The tasting experience doesn’t feel like you’re being herded through a script. There’s room to ask questions and actually have conversations about what you’re drinking.

Temecula’s wine country can get crowded on weekends, especially during peak season, so if you’re planning to visit with your dog, a weekday trip might be more pleasant. The private estate setup means crowds are naturally limited compared to larger public tasting rooms. Before heading out, check their website for current hours and any special events happening that day, as these can affect the regular tasting schedule. The location works well if you’re already exploring the Temecula wine region and want a quieter, more dog-friendly stop along the way.
